Corona in India: India reports 39,070 new cases in the last 24 hours. The active caseload of the country is currently at 4,06,822. Active cases constitute 1.27% of the total cases.


The country registered 491 deaths on Saturday, as per the Union Health Ministry.

The weekly positivity rate remains below 5%, currently at 2.38%. The daily positivity rate at 2.27%; less than 3% for the last 13 days.


Kerala 


Kerala on Saturday reported 20,367 new Covid cases and 139 deaths, taking the active caseload in the state to 1,78,166, while the toll reached 17,654. In the last 24 hours, 1,52,521 samples were tested and the test positivity rate (TPR) was found to be 13.35 per cent.


Additionally, a COVID-19 vaccination drive will be held in Kerala from August 9 to 31 informed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an on Saturday. 


"In addition to the vaccines available to the state government, more vaccines need to be made available to the private sector. The state government will buy 20 lakh doses of vaccines and provide them to private hospitals at the same rate. The distribution will be based on the number of vaccines that can be given through each private hospital, commercial institutions and public organizations can arrange vaccination from the purchased vaccines for local people with the participation of hospitals. The local self-government Institutions can arrange facilities for this. The goal is to vaccinate as many as possible at the earliest," said Pinarayi Vijayan while interacting with reporters in a COVID-19 review meeting on Saturday.


Maharashtra 


Maharashtra on Saturday reported 6,061 new coronavirus disease (Covid-19) cases and 128 related deaths, a marginal rise in infections from the previous day. The state has recorded 6,347,820 Covid-19 cases so far of which 133,845 patients have succumbed to the disease and 6,139,493 have recovered.


With 332 new infections and five deaths, Mumbai's overall caseload and fatalities stand at 737,192 and 15,942 respectively. Maharashtra recorded a rise in Covid-19 cases the day chief minister Uddhav Thackeray indicated to further ease restrictions that were imposed to contain the virus surge.
